Thank you for the comments! The spotlight has a material, in which only the luminosity channel is on, the power of it depends on the scene you work. After render there was some PS postwork, and I use a PS plugin called Knoll Light Factory. This is a very useful plugin, for lens flaire or addin some extra light effects to the scene! ;) These are buisness conference rooms for smaller teams. ;)
